Book Review of
Colonial Law in America

By Robert M. Reed

Did you ever wonder what type of laws existed in Colonial America? This book is full of different facts that existed in the various colonies dealing with all kinds of situations. Some of the subjects covered include: adultery; babbling women; cursing; drunkenness; guns in church; idleness; Sabbath breakers; stealing, witchcraft and other topics. The reading is both quite horrifying and humorous. Some of the information sounds like living in a third world country. It makes you appreciate living in the current United States.

The 6” x 9” softbound book has 30 black and white post card photos that illustrate colonial areas. The book retails for $16.99 and has 128 pages.  It would make great reading for a history buff or just a humorous gift for someone looking for trivial information.
